Ticket #— Floor 9 Opening Prep, Brindlemoor House

Hi facilities folks, Floor 9 opens to staff next Monday and we need a few things squared away before then. Lift access is live, but the two side doors by the kitchenette are still on the old lock config — please reprogram them before Friday. Also, signage for the quiet rooms hasn't arrived, so pop up the temporary printed ones for now. Until the badge readers sync, the interim door code for Floor 9 is below.

door code, bajop-bajog: bdg-DSWAC-43621

[ ] Key ceremony step 7 — Quillbase planner regression. Before rotating the signing keys, confirm the Marrowfield query planner is pinned to the pre-regression build; the new cost model misorders joins on the audit tables and will stall the ceremony log writes. Verify pin, run the smoke query twice, record timings in the ceremony sheet. If the planner check passes, unseal the backup shard with the recovery passphrase below.

recovery phrase for fafof-kagaf: eliath-zormir

Subject: Quickstore 4.2 — bloom filter now fronts the KV layer

Plugin authors: starting with this release, Quickstore places a bloom filter ahead of the key-value store. Negative lookups return faster; false positives fall through safely. No API changes are required on your side. Verify your plugin against the staging build referenced below.

session token of fahif-tadup = htk3_9c7

### Step 4 — Deploy the FD Tracer Plugin

After building your plugin for the Gullwatch descriptor-leak hunt, package it as a signed bundle; the Tiderunner host refuses unsigned tracers since they attach to live processes. Verify the bundle locally, then push it to the staging hook. Signing requires the plugin deploy key, which appears below.

signing key of bagap-yawep = bky13_TbfT6ZMUoGJo2